Макросы в Excel VBA — эффективный способ автоматизации

Если вы хотите сделать свою работу в Excel более эффективной и экономить время, то вам наверняка стоит познакомиться с макросами в Excel VBA. Макросы — это набор инструкций, которые записываются и затем могут быть выполнены автоматически. Это отличный способ автоматизировать рутинные задачи, устранить ошибки и повысить производительность.

Одним из способов запуска макросов в Excel VBA является использование другого макроса. Вы можете создать основной макрос, который вызывает другие макросы в определенной последовательности. Это особенно полезно, если у вас есть несколько макросов, которые должны быть выполнены поочередно или в определенном порядке.

Чтобы запустить макрос в Excel VBA, вы можете использовать различные методы, включая назначение макроса горячей клавишей, добавление кнопки на панель инструментов или использование событий, таких как открытие или сохранение файла. Вы также можете запускать макросы вручную, выбрав их из списка всех макросов в Excel.

При запуске макроса в Excel VBA у вас есть возможность передавать параметры в макрос и получать результаты обратно. Это позволяет создать более гибкие макросы, которые могут выполнять различные операции в зависимости от переданных параметров.

Не стесняйтесь экспериментировать с макросами в Excel VBA и создавать свои собственные автоматизированные процессы. Этот мощный инструмент позволяет сэкономить время и сделать вашу работу более эффективной. И помните, что только практика делает искусство!

Важность автоматизации макросов в Excel с использованием VBA

Автоматизация макросами в Excel с помощью VBA позволяет существенно ускорить процессы работы с данными, повысить точность и надежность операций, а также сэкономить время и ресурсы. Вместо того чтобы выполнять однотипные задачи вручную, VBA-макросы позволяют автоматизировать их выполнение, что особенно полезно при обработке больших объемов данных.

Одним из важных преимуществ автоматизации макросами в Excel является возможность создания пользовательских интерфейсов, которые позволяют упростить работу с данными даже для пользователей без опыта программирования. Макросы могут быть оформлены в виде кнопок на панели инструментов или в виде диалоговых окон с настройками операций, что делает процесс работы с данными более интуитивным и доступным.

Кроме того, автоматизация макросами в Excel помогает избежать ошибок, связанных с человеческим фактором. Когда одни и те же действия выполняются вручную, вероятность возникновения ошибок увеличивается. В отличие от этого, макросы работают по заранее заданным правилам и инструкциям, что позволяет значительно снизить вероятность ошибок и обеспечить более точные результаты.

Таким образом, автоматизация макросами в Excel с использованием VBA является неотъемлемой частью работы с данными. Она позволяет улучшить производительность, упростить процессы обработки данных и снизить вероятность ошибок. И, конечно, при использовании эффективных макросов, пользователи Excel смогут сосредоточиться на анализе данных и принятии обоснованных решений, вместо того чтобы тратить время на рутинные операции.

Читайте также:  Мастер устранения неполадок центра обновления windows 10

Что такое VBA и какую роль она играет в Excel

Visual Basic for Applications (VBA) — это язык программирования, который интегрирован в большинство программ Microsoft Office, включая Excel. Это мощный инструмент, который позволяет пользователям создавать и редактировать макросы, а также автоматизировать разнообразные задачи в Excel.

Одной из наиболее полезных возможностей VBA является возможность создания макросов. Макросы представляют собой серию действий, которые можно записать и воспроизвести в любое время. Это означает, что вы можете записать последовательность действий, которые обычно выполняются вручную, и затем вызвать этот макрос для автоматического выполнения этих действий. Например, вы можете создать макрос, который сортирует данные по определенным критериям или вставляет формулы в определенные ячейки.

VBA также позволяет пользователям создавать пользовательские функции, которые могут быть использованы для выполнения специальных операций и расчетов. Эти функции дополняют стандартные функции Excel и позволяют пользователям создавать более гибкие и мощные формулы.

В целом, VBA открывает перед пользователями Excel огромные возможности для автоматизации задач, улучшения продуктивности и создания более сложных приложений. В зависимости от уровня компетентности, пользователи могут использовать VBA для создания простых макросов или воплощения в жизнь самых сложных решений, которые помогут в решении специфических задач.

Так что, если вы хотите упростить свою работу с данными в Excel и сэкономить время, обратите внимание на VBA и его возможности. Начните с изучения основ этого языка программирования и возможно вам потребуется он для выполнения сложных задач.

Разъяснение концепта «макроса» в Excel

Создание макроса в Excel довольно просто. Сначала необходимо записать желаемую последовательность действий, которые вы хотите автоматизировать. Затем макрос можно назначить на кнопку или горячую клавишу, чтобы иметь быстрый доступ к его выполнению. После того, как макрос будет создан, он будет выполнять заданные вами действия в точности так, как вы записали их, что может сэкономить вам массу времени и усилий.

Макросы в Excel позволяют сократить количество рутинной работы и существенно повысить эффективность вашей работы. Они могут быть использованы для автоматизации различных задач, таких как создание отчетов, фильтрация и сортировка данных, форматирование листов и многое другое. Это особенно полезно для пользователей, которые работают с большими объемами данных или выполняют однотипные операции на ежедневной основе.

Основные преимущества использования макросов в Excel

Макросы в Excel представляют собой мощный инструмент автоматизации, который может значительно повысить эффективность и производительность работы с данными. Они позволяют автоматически выполнять рутинные задачи, упрощая процессы и экономя время.

Одним из главных преимуществ использования макросов является возможность повышения точности и надежности обработки данных. Человеческий фактор может привести к ошибкам при ручной обработке и анализе больших объемов информации. Макросы же выполняют заданные команды точно и последовательно, минимизируя возможность ошибок. Это особенно важно при работе с чувствительными данными, такими как финансовые или клиентские данные.

Кроме того, использование макросов позволяет автоматизировать сложные задачи и процессы, которые требуют множества шагов. Например, можно создать макрос для автоматического форматирования и расчета данных, создания отчетов или графиков на основе заданных параметров. Вместо того чтобы выполнять эти задачи вручную, макрос выполняет все необходимые действия автоматически, что позволяет сэкономить много времени и усилий.

Читайте также:  Как использовать Excel для выделения ячеек разными цветами

Другим важным преимуществом макросов является их универсальность и возможность повторного использования. Созданный однажды макрос может быть применен в различных рабочих книгах или к разным наборам данных, что позволяет значительно сократить количество необходимого кода и упростить его поддержку. Использование макросов также способствует повышению эффективности работы, поскольку позволяет сфокусироваться на более сложных и значимых задачах.

Шаги по запуску макроса в Excel с использованием VBA

Если вы хотите автоматизировать выполнение определенных действий в Excel, вы можете использовать макросы с помощью VBA (Visual Basic for Applications). Макросы позволяют вам записать серию команд и выполнить их одним нажатием кнопки или горячей клавишей. В этой статье я расскажу вам о нескольких шагах, которые помогут вам запустить макрос в Excel с использованием VBA.

Шаг 1: Открыть редактор VBA

Первым шагом для запуска макроса в Excel с использованием VBA является открытие редактора VBA. Чтобы сделать это, откройте вашу книгу Excel, затем нажмите на вкладку «Разработчик» в верхней панели меню. Если у вас нет вкладки «Разработчик», вам нужно будет ее активировать в настройках Excel. После открытия вкладки «Разработчик», нажмите на кнопку «Редактор VBA». В результате откроется окно редактора VBA, где вы сможете создавать и редактировать макросы.

Шаг 2: Создать новый модуль VBA

После открытия редактора VBA в Excel, вам нужно создать новый модуль VBA, где вы будете записывать ваш макрос. Чтобы создать новый модуль, щелкните правой кнопкой мыши на разделе «Microsoft Excel объекты» в окне проекта, затем выберите «Вставить» и из выпадающего меню выберите «Модуль». В результате откроется новое окно модуля, где вы можете начать написание вашего макроса.

Шаг 3: Написать макрос

Теперь вы можете приступить к написанию вашего макроса в модуле VBA. Вы можете использовать язык программирования VBA для записи нужных команд. Например, вы можете создать макрос, который скопирует данные из одной ячейки в другую, или макрос, который выполнит сложные вычисления. При написании макроса учтите, что он должен быть структурированным и понятным для последующего использования. Вы также можете добавить комментарии в коде макроса, чтобы легче понимать его действие. Когда ваш макрос готов, сохраните его и закройте редактор VBA.

Это были основные шаги по запуску макроса в Excel с использованием VBA. Все, что осталось, это назначить ваш макрос на кнопку или горячую клавишу, чтобы его можно было запустить. Вы можете сделать это, перейдя в режим редактирования ленты, добавив новую вкладку и создав новую группу команд со ссылкой на ваш макрос. Теперь у вас есть возможность выполнять автоматизированные задачи в Excel с помощью вашего созданного макроса.

Как избежать ошибок при запуске макроса в Excel с использованием VBA

Запуск макроса в Excel с использованием языка программирования VBA может быть очень полезным при автоматизации повторяющихся задач. Однако, при написании и запуске макросов, могут возникать ошибки, которые могут привести к неверным результатам или даже сбоям в работе программы. В этой статье мы рассмотрим несколько способов, как избежать таких ошибок и сделать ваш макрос более надежным.

Во-первых, при написании макроса убедитесь, что вы правильно определили переменные и указали правильные параметры функций. Проверяйте ваши строки кода на предмет опечаток и убеждайтесь, что все имена переменных и функций написаны правильно. Неправильно указанные переменные или параметры могут привести к ошибкам выполнения макроса.

Читайте также:  Windows have no sill

Во-вторых, старайтесь предусмотреть все возможные ситуации и обработать их заранее. Например, если ваш макрос использует пользовательский ввод, убедитесь, что вы проверяете правильность введенных данных и обрабатываете возможные ошибки. Это поможет избежать непредвиденных сбоев в работе программы.

Также, рекомендуется использовать отладчик при разработке макросов. Он позволяет вам шаг за шагом выполнять код макроса и отслеживать его выполнение. При обнаружении ошибок вы сможете легко их исправить и убедиться в правильности работы макроса.

Наконец, не забывайте о проверке вашего макроса на небольших наборах данных или тестовых файлах перед его применением на больших объемах данных. Это поможет выявить возможные ошибки или непредвиденные результаты работы макроса и внести необходимые корректировки.

Возможные проблемы при запуске макроса в Excel и их решения

Запуск макросов в Excel может стать сложной задачей для многих пользователей. Однако, решение проблем, которые могут возникнуть, может быть проще, чем кажется. В этой статье рассмотрим некоторые распространенные проблемы и их решения, чтобы помочь вам успешно запускать макросы в Excel.

1. Отключен макросы в настройках безопасности

Если макросы не запускаются, в первую очередь, убедитесь, что настройки безопасности Excel позволяют запуск макросов. В меню «Файл» выберите «Параметры», затем перейдите на вкладку «Центр управления безопасностью». Установите уровень безопасности на «Средний» или «Низкий», чтобы разрешить запуск макросов.

2. Неигровое имя макроса или неправильное обращение к нему

Если макрос не запускается, причиной может быть его некорректное название или неправильное обращение к нему в коде. Убедитесь, что имя макроса написано правильно и что код обращается к нему с использованием правильного синтаксиса. Также может быть полезно проверить, нет ли опечаток или других ошибок в коде макроса.

3. Проблемы с путями к файлам и зависимыми библиотеками

Если макросы в Excel используют другие файлы или зависимые библиотеки, убедитесь, что пути к этим файлам указаны правильно в коде макроса. Также проверьте, что файлы и библиотеки, необходимые для работы макроса, доступны на вашем компьютере. В случае отсутствия нужных файлов или библиотек, макрос может не запуститься или выдать ошибку.

4. Ошибки в коде макроса

Если все вышеперечисленные решения не помогли, возможно, проблема кроется в самом коде макроса. Внимательно просмотрите код и убедитесь, что в нем нет ошибок или опечаток. Ошибки в коде могут привести к некорректной работе или неработоспособности макроса. Программирование на VBA требует определенного уровня навыков, поэтому в случае трудностей может быть полезно обратиться к специалистам или проконсультироваться в интернете.

Запуск макросов в Excel может вызывать некоторые проблемы, но с правильным подходом и знанием возможных причин и решений, эти проблемы могут быть легко преодолены. Убедитесь, что настройки безопасности позволяют запуск макросов, проверьте правильность названия и обращения к макросу, убедитесь в наличии необходимых файлов и библиотек, а также внимательно просмотрите код макроса на наличие ошибок. С учетом этих рекомендаций вы сможете успешно запускать макросы в Excel и сэкономить время и усилия при работе с этой программой.

Оцените статью